Read moreDetailsEvans Jr., is a Researcher, Communication Specialist, and Writer with over four years of professional experience. His research experience includes serving as the Head of Research at the National Union of Ghanaian Students (NUGS) and as a Teaching & Research Assistant in the Department of Political Science at the University of Education, Winneba. Currently, Evans Jr. is the Head of Political Desk at The Vaultz News, an online media firm based in Accra. His role involves overseeing political news production, leading a team in real-time reporting, and providing in-depth analysis of government policies, elections, and legislative developments. He’s a PK Amoabeng Leadership Scholar and a member of Ghana's inaugural Youth Advisory Board under the Elevating Youth Voices Project, playing a key role in the drafting of the National Handbook on Values (NHoV), a crucial resource aimed at instilling core ethical and leadership values in secondary school students across the nation. Driven by a passion for justice and good governance, Evans Jr. aspires to become a Legal Practitioner while continuing to contribute to global governance and public policy discourse. His work is fueled by a commitment to ethical leadership, impactful research, and meaningful communication.
